Khurana et al., Endocrinology 2000
(Hyperprolactinemia) :
BPA , OP, and, to a lesser extent, DES
increased the expression of both ERalpha and
ERbeta in the anterior pituitary of males, but not females, whereas the hypothalamic ERs were less responsive to these compounds
Matthews et al., Chem Res Toxicol 2001
(Breast Neoplasms) :
These results demonstrate that
BPA competes more effectively for binding to ERbeta, but
induces ERalpha- and
ERbeta mediated gene expression with comparable efficacy
Hess-Wilson et al., Environ Health Perspect 2007
(Adenocarcinoma...) :
BPA dramatically
attenuated estrogen receptor beta (ERbeta) expression ; this finding was specific to prostate tumor cells in which BPA induces cellular proliferation
